NymCard

Senior Java Backend Engineer

NymCard

full-time

Posted on:

Location Type: Remote

Location: Remote • 🇮🇳 India

Visit company website
AI Apply
Apply

Job Level

Senior

Tech Stack

Distributed SystemsJavaKafkaMongoDBNoSQLOraclePostgresRabbitMQSQL

About the role

  • Design and build APIs supporting NymCard's real-time payment infrastructure, processing millions of transactions with focus on scalability, performance, and reliability
  • Own and drive the design of scalable backend services and APIs that power real-time payments
  • Collaborate closely with Product, DevOps, and Engineering leads to align system capabilities with business goals
  • Contribute to architectural decision-making, balancing performance, security, and maintainability
  • Lead initiatives to evolve the platform from project-based delivery toward a unified product architecture
  • Conduct thoughtful code reviews, raise engineering standards, and mentor others through technical leadership
  • Troubleshoot and resolve complex production issues with a focus on root-cause elimination
  • Influence and support the adoption of best practices in API design, observability, and operational resilience
  • Provide input into roadmap planning from a technical feasibility and scalability perspective

Requirements

  • 5+ years of hands-on Java backend development experience, ideally with distributed systems
  • A strong foundation in system design, architecture, and scalability principles
  • Proficiency in relational and NoSQL databases (e.g. PostgreSQL, MongoDB, SQL Server, Oracle)
  • Deep understanding of RESTful API design, OpenAPI standards, and API gateway patterns
  • Experience designing or integrating with messaging systems like Kafka, RabbitMQ, Amazon SQS/SNS in event-driven architectures
  • Experience working closely with Product, DevOps, and cross-functional teams to deliver aligned solutions
  • Knowledge of secure coding practices, data privacy, and application-level security
  • Familiarity with CI/CD pipelines, agile delivery, and modern software practices
  • Strong communication skills — able to explain technical concepts to non-technical audiences
  • Bonus Points — Experience evolving monoliths or legacy systems into modular platform architectures
  • Bonus Points — Exposure to payments infrastructure, such as card issuing, settlement, or transaction clearing
  • Bonus Points — Familiarity with PCI DSS compliance and security audits
  • Bonus Points — Hands-on experience scaling platforms in high-growth or regulated environments
  • Bonus Points — Contributions to engineering culture, such as mentorship, knowledge-sharing, or internal tooling initiatives
  • Bonus Points — Past experience working in product-first engineering teams or helping shape roadmaps from a technical lens
Benefits
  • Remote work (India)
  • Open and collaborative work environment
  • Opportunities for mentorship and technical leadership

ATS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ard skills
JavaAPI designsystem designarchitecturescalabilityrelational databasesNoSQL databasesRESTful APIsCI/CDsecure coding practices
Soft skills
communicationtechnical leadershipmentorshipcollaborationtroubleshootinginfluencecode reviewproblem-solvingorganizational skillsadaptability
Certifications
PCI DSS compliance
Keycard Labs

Staff Data Engineer

Keycard Labs
Leadfull-time🇨🇦 Canada
Posted: 23 days agoSource: jobs.ashbyhq.com
Distributed SystemsGoHerokuKafkaOpen SourcePythonRust
Vista

Senior Software Engineer

Vista
Seniorfull-time🇹🇳 Tunisia
Posted: 26 days agoSource: jobs.vista.com
AWSCloudJavaJavaScriptKafkaMicroservicesNode.jsNoSQLSparkSQLTerraform
Netflix

Software Engineer 4, Revenue Finance Infrastructure

Netflix
Mid · Seniorfull-time$100k–$700k / year🇺🇸 United States
Posted: 22 days agoSource: netflix.wd1.myworkdayjobs.com
AWSAzureCloudDistributed SystemsGoogle Cloud PlatformJavaKafkaScalaSpark
WillHire

Senior Manager, Software Development Engineering – Graph Processing

WillHire
Seniorfull-time🇮🇪 Ireland
Posted: 2 days agoSource: workday.wd5.myworkdayjobs.com
Distributed SystemsJava
DDN

Staff Software Engineer

DDN
Leadfull-timeColorado · 🇺🇸 United States
Posted: 5 days agoSource: careers-ddn.icims.com
AnsibleApacheCloudDistributed SystemsDockerGoHDFSJavaKafkaLinuxPythonScala+3 more